As we were in the proximity, we took another opportunity and visited one of the most beautiful Castles: The Hunyad Castle in Hunedoara. As we got there the sun was up n the sky and i had the courage first time this year to leave my winter coat in the car. I've only seen the castle in pictures or on TV long time ago and never thought I'll get to see it. So I've enjoyed that visit very much. This castle, built in 14th century, has both Gothic and Renaissance elements. It has an impressive drawbridge and defense towers. It is built on a rock. You can also visit the chapel or the room of Knights. There's the legend of Turk prisoners that dug a well of 30 meters deep in stone, hoping that they will be set free. But the owner of the castle at that moment died and his wife broke the promise he made to them and sentenced them to death. So they carved in the wall: "you have water, but no soul". There is also the place were prisoners were thrown to animals. Cruel history, beautiful architecture. The place is also available for special events like weddings, corporate events, medieval festivals etc.











We also visited Sarmizegetusa Regia Ulpia Traiana the former Dacian capital and religious center, a great site to visit by those that have a passion for history. 



The last but not least place we went to was the city of Targu Jiu. Here we visited the park especially for Constantin Brancusi work of art displayed there: the Endless column, the Table of silence, the Kiss gate.
